I'm checking the wiring on my 65 before hooking up the battery as it hasn't been hooked up in 10-15 years. I see a couple of wires that have clearly shorted, and a few others that appear hacked.

My question is, what is the yellow switch on the dash above the lights? Is it stock? Seems to have a suspicious amount of hacked/nonstock wires attached to it. Thanks, Duane

The switch looks stock but the knob should be black like this. It was the switch for the dome light on most FJ40's.
image.jpeg
If no dome light was installed or it was a FJ45 LPB, then it had a small flush grey plug in the original hole.
 
Interesting Mark, I've got 4 '65s in the barn I'll have to check closer but I don't believe I've seen it on any of mine that I can remember. But my Australian parts book does show what it calls a "general purpose" switch in that area.
